Puns and Double Meanings

Puns and double meanings are a staple of wordplay. By using words or phrases that have multiple meanings, you can create clever and catchy trivia names that play on words. For example, a trivia called “Brain Food” could use puns related to food and brain function to create a memorable name.

  • Airhead Trivia: A trivia focused on music and pop culture, using puns like “head banging” and “rocking” to create a catchy name.
  • History Makers: A history-themed trivia using puns like “making history” and “historical makers” to create a memorable name.
  • Math-a-Tics: A math-themed trivia using double meanings like “math” and “math-a-tics” to create a catchy name.

Clever Alliterations

Clever alliterations involve using words that start with the same sound to create a catchy and memorable name. By leverging alliterations, you can create trivia names that are easy to remember and fun to say.

  • Quiz Whiz: A trivia focused on general knowledge, using alliterations like “quiz” and “whiz” to create a catchy name.
  • Science Scene: A science-themed trivia using alliterations like “science” and “scene” to create a memorable name.
  • Word Wizards: A word games-themed trivia using alliterations like “word” and “wizards” to create a catchy name.

Recurring Themes in Trivia Name Creation

There are several recurring themes that appear in trivia team names, including geography, pop culture, humor, and clever twists on the word “Trivia”. These themes not only add a creative touch to the team name but also provide a way to connect with other teams and enthusiasts.### Geography-inspired Team NamesTrivial Pursuits from the 42nd ParallelThe Name: Trivial Pursuits from the 42nd ParallelThe Creative Reasoning: The team name incorporates a play on words, referencing the classic board game Trivial Pursuit, while also highlighting the team’s geographical roots in North America.### Pop Culture-inspired Team NamesThe Office Space InvadersThe Name: The Office Space InvadersThe Creative Reasoning: This team name takes a cue from the popular TV show The Office, combining it with a nod to the classic video game Space Invaders.### Humor-inspired Team NamesQuestionable DecisionsThe Name: Questionable DecisionsThe Creative Reasoning: This team name pokes fun at the idea that a trivia team might make questionable decisions during the competition.### Clever Twists on the Word “Trivia”The TriviamaticsThe Name: The TriviamaticsThe Creative Reasoning: This team name incorporates a playful twist on the word “Trivia”, incorporating the suffix “-omatics” to create a fun and catchy name.
